Islam is a monotheistic religion (belief in a single supreme being)...just as Christianity and Judaism are monotheistic. Allah is merely the Arabic word for God. Both Muslims (pronounced MOOS-lims) and Arab Christians pray to Allah. Muslims believe Jesus (and Noah and Moses) were prophets, and that Jesus was born of a virgin Mary, but do not believe Jesus was the son of God.(God is so powerful that he doesn't need a son or partner.)

Do you realize that the last time the U.S. had a president with an ethnicity other than English or Irish was Dwight Eisenhower from 1953-1961? In wonder if people were concerned he was the anti-Christ because we were less than a decade removed from WWII and Eisenhower is of German ethnicity?
